Massa says Williams still 'in the fight'

– Williams driver Felipe Massa reckons the team still has the raw speed to challenge Mercedes this season, despite falling behind Ferrari at the opening two rounds.Sebastian Vettel edged out Massa for the final podium spot in Australia, and went on to claim victory in Malaysia, with Massa a distant sixth, just behind team-mate Valtteri Bottas.Williams currently sits third in the championship standings on 30 points, 22 adrift of Ferrari and a further 24 behind Mercedes, but Massa is confident that progress will be made."I think we cannot complain about how we start the season," said Massa."You always want to be on top, but we are third in the championship, so we scored...
